In another unrelated post I mentioned thus:
"I've been side-tracked by a domestic project - the electric remote garage door operator has decided to give up the ghost. It's worked faultlessly since I installed it about ten years ago to replace one that had packed up. Yesterday the remotes wouldn't work, but it works when the wall mounted directly wired push button switch is pressed. I've tried reprogramming the remotes to no avail, and basically, the upshot is that the 'logic board' - quite a complex thing with SMDs and ICs on a double-sided PCB, has developed a fault. A new board is available at £100 or so, but a complete new garage door opener can be had for £200 or so. Hence, it's a high risk strategy to fit a new board if something like the motor packs in err too long".
Had another look at the PCB and noted that it has a 330uF 35V electrolytic on it, which looked as though it was bulging at the top. Nothing ventured, nothing gained, so I removed it (a bit tricky on a PTH PCB), and replaced it. More in hope than expectations, I re-programmed the remote (not as impressive a task as it sounds - just press and hold the button on the remote till a light on the motor unit stops flashing), and bingo - the blighter works fine!
So, saved myself £200 + and the hassle of removing what was otherwise a perfectly serviceable unit, and fitting a new one.
